    Naomi S.

    What a fun time we had! We booked a reservation online and picked the lane that we wanted to be in. On the day of our reservation, they ask that you arrive 15 min early so that they can "train" you on how to throw an axe. After they go through their training, they let you throw the axe and give you feedback on how you did and, if needed, how you can improve. After everyone has thrown their practice axe, the time starts ticking. Our time slot was for an hour which was enough time for 5 people. I think there were 3 different types of games you can play (Bullseye, Monopoly & can't remember what the other one was). We all agreed that we liked the Bullseye game the best. I don't have the best aim so I was surprised that I won 2 out of 3 games and even got a Bullseye! The Monopoly and the other game was more of a skilled game where you had to knock out each square. If you happen to hit a square that someone else already hit, it's considered a "miss" and you've lost your turn. My oldest had a great time and said that she wanted to do it for another hour. We vetoed that idea as I'm sure that my husband and my back/shoulder will be sore tomorrow, lol.

    Maria S.

    Recently ax throwing has been all the craze. At first, I was a little nervous because...well it's ax throwing! In either case, I recently agreed to join my friends in the festivities. We made reservations online and followed up with a call to the venue to secure (2) lanes side by side (since we were a larger group)--and they were able to accommodate us with that request. The two lanes we had reserved were recently updated with a program that was sort of like a hologram on the board. We could select from different options/games to play and in our 1.5-hour time slot we were able to get a few rounds of a couple of different games. Some important things to know before attending ax-throwing is that you will have to wear closed-toe shoes, it is recommended to book online to secure your spot(s), once you arrive you will have to fill out and sign a waiver (you can do this through your smartphone with the QR code reader they give you and will take less than (2) minutes), you will have to undergo "training" so I suggest arriving a few minutes before your time slot officially begins because it will cut into your time. Other cool tips are that you can bring beer and/or wine as well as light bites/snacks to munch on while there--just no liquor. We had a great time and I look forward to going back!

    Ask the Community - Extreme Axe Throwing Hollywood

    Hi! I was wondering if we can we bring our own snacks in addition to the drinks, or is it just drinks?

    Hello Zainab, We have BYOB so you can bring your food and drinks no hard liquor please. Thank you.

    How old do you have to be Would like to take my daughters 17 and 18?

    We have no age limit! Our youngest trainee has been 5 years old! As long as the child can hold & throw we will teach them. And they also must be under parental supervision

    Is this BYOB?

    Yes, we are! Beer and wine are welcome, we just ask no hard liquor is brought on-premises.
